Transaction 95ed1e890075792a1c392be5347f63a6bfbb27cb229a7a628c2b07a579199e86

69 Input
2 Outputs
  • 95ed1e890075792a1c392be5347f63a6bfbb27cb229a7a628c2b07a579199e86:0
  • value  1000806487
    address  1EQcMav4zqcuES2JPsxuMbXqjmWiHUvFMM
  • 95ed1e890075792a1c392be5347f63a6bfbb27cb229a7a628c2b07a579199e86:1
  • value  1833301
    address  14wfMbbH6oZVQXQdQwRsGiLATUsMBvs8rW